JOB SUMMARY:

The Recruiter is responsible for recruiting and screening candidates for potential employment at Hancock Health. This position is also responsible for maintaining an external presence at educational institutions, job fairs, and professional organizations to recruit candidates and promote health care careers to all ages.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Coordinate and manage all recruitment processes - opening a job, internal (Job Hotline) and external job posting, reviewing applications, working with departmental leadership to determine the correct hire. This includes utilizing all types of recruitment efforts including cold calling, direct mail, prior candidate database maintenance, etc.
  • Facilitating the entire job offer process including paperwork, Occupational Health visit, criminal history check, licensure, all other required documentation gathering and data entry into Ascentis and Meditech.
  • Professionally interacting with candidates and customers either via the telephone or face-to-face.
  • Responsible for all recruitment technology including the applicant tracking system, Canvas texting software, etc.
  • Maintain organizational presence at educational institutions (colleges and high schools) by attending job fairs/career days, classroom opportunities, etc.
  • Maintain organizational presence with professional organizations and their applicable conference and publications.
  • Working with outplacement and temporary placement vendors (as needed) to include: establishing the financial arrangement, prescreening candidates, processing billing statements, etc. This includes maintaining organizational records of contract labor.
  • The Recruiter is expected to participate with the rest of the HR team to assist visitors, answer phones, and general duties as needed. The position will also manage projects as needed.
  • All other duties as assigned by the department or the organization.

Hancock Health is an Indiana-based, full-service healthcare network serving Hancock County and the surrounding areas. Our health system includes Hancock Regional Hospital, Hancock Physician Network and more than 20 other healthcare facilities, such as wellness centers, women's clinics, family practices, and the Sue Ann Wortman Cancer Center.
